Investors targeting diversification within the broad market often turn to S&P 500 sector ETFs. These exchange-traded funds provide targeted exposure to specific sectors of the U.S. economy, allowing investors to leverage industry-specific trends and growth opportunities. Analyzing the performance of these ETFs highlights valuable insights into sector volatility, which can inform investment approaches.
A key consideration when scrutinizing sector ETF performance is the inherent volatility associated with each industry. Some sectors, such as technology and healthcare, are known for their high profitability, while others, like energy or utilities, may be more cyclical in nature.
Additionally, it's crucial to consider the underlying holdings of each ETF to understand its true exposure to a specific sector. Some ETFs may have a more concentrated portfolio, while others offer broader diversification within a particular industry group.

Diversifying Your Portfolio with S&P 500 Sector ETFs
When constructing a well-rounded financial plan, it's essential to spread the risk across different sectors of the market. This mitigates overall risk and enhances the likelihood for returns. S&P 500 Sector ETFs provide a convenient tool to achieve this diversification by investing a specific sector within the broad S&P 500 index. From healthcare to consumer discretionary, these ETFs offer targeted exposure allowing investors to optimize their portfolios based on their risk tolerance.
Before selecting an ETF, it's crucial to understand your investment horizon and {risk appetite|. Consider factors such as sector performance, fund expenses, and trading volume. Researching each ETF's holdings and investment strategy can help you make an informed decision that corresponds with your overall investment strategy.
